Soil Moisture Sensors



Soil moisture sensing units play an essential role in modern irrigation systems, supplying real-time information that enhances water performance. These tools determine the volumetric water content in the dirt, enabling accurate assessments of moisture degrees. By integrating dirt wetness sensors into watering systems, individuals can avoid overwatering or underwatering, inevitably promoting much healthier plant growth and conserving water resources.The sensing units transmit information to controllers, which can change watering timetables based upon existing dirt problems. This data-driven technique reduces water waste and warranties that plants receive the ideal amount of dampness. What Is the Life-span of Modern Lawn Sprinkler System Components?





The life expectancy of modern-day lawn sprinkler components usually ranges from 5 to two decades, relying on the products utilized, maintenance practices, and ecological conditions. Normal upkeep can significantly boost toughness and performance gradually.
